Badgers down Stevens Point in final exhibition

November 8, 2013 By Bill Scott

The Wisconsin Badger women’s basketball team won their final preseason tune-up, knocking off UW-Stevens Point 80-51 on Thursday night at the Kohl Center.

Stevens Point jumped out early and led 12-5.  The Pointers didn’t relinquish the lead until 9:17 of the first half when the Badgers went up 21-19.

From that point, the Badgers closed out the 1st half outscoring the Pointers 22-10 to take a 41-29 halftime lead.

Michala Johnson had 18 points to lead the Badgers, who shot better than 50-percent from the floor for the second straight game (56.5%).

Wisconsin opens the regular season on Sunday when it hosts Drake in non-conference action.  Tip time is 2pm at the Kohl Center.
